描述Investigations into the mechanisms of spennatogenesis, sperm matura­ tion and fertilization provide the basis of our understanding of male re­ productive physiology. Since in recent years molecular and cellular en­ docrinology has provided particularly important contributions to our knowledge, the European Workshops on Molecular and Celluar Endo­ crinology of the Testis, held regularly during even years since 1980, have become a prominent forum for researchers in the field to discuss recent findings and exchange new ideas. The most recent of these Testis Workshops, the 7th, was held on May 5 - 10, 1992 at Castle Elmau in the Bavarian Alps. The main lectures of this Workshops form the core of this book. In order to provide a broader view of the current status of male re­ production research, this volume also contains the proceedings of the Schering Foundation Workshop on "Basic Mechanisms of Reproduc­ tion and Male Fertility Control" which was held in Berlin on October 31 to November 2, 1991.
